Couple things here...

It's stylistically not a great matchup for Merab. His striking is not good, he's a TD machine with a nonstop motor. But Dodson is almost impossible to hold down, and cardio shouldn't be an issue in a 3 round fight. Plus Dodson has power so if Merab's striking defense is as bad as it's been at various times, he might eat a big shot and get finished.

The other (and probably more important) thing is...if you think the line is "right", why would you ever consider a 4u play??? If the line is right, take a pass. Or put a tiny bet on a prop or something if you just want action. Making a big play on a line where you think the books have it correct? There's no reason to do that, put your money in spots where you think the line is way off.
